King Power plays host to a lower league side this week. Tranmere will hope to contest a weakened Leicester starting lineup, and that is exactly what Foxes of Leicester predict. The Merseyside are currently 12th in division three, for all intents and purposes.

Therefore I am unsure that the away club will be able to withstand even the second string LCFC XI and its substitutes. Danny Ward or Daniel Iversen could come into goal with Mads Hermansen generally so dominant as No.1. Jakub Stolarczyk is ruled out through injury.

Caleb Okoli and Ricardo Pereira will almost undoubtedly play respective roles in the fixture. Both will be feeling hard done by that they aren't in at the start of EPL clashes. Luke Thomas is likely to receive his maiden opportunity under the former Nottingham Forest gaffer.

Up-and-coming Foxes such as Will Alves, Sammy Braybrooke, Ben Nelson and Tom Cannon would have been eager to test themselves and catch Cooper's eye against Rovers. However, there is a chance that none of them feature in the domestic competition. But more on that later.

Elsewhere, I'll be looking for midfielders Oliver Skipp and Michael Golding. Not to mention winger Stephy Mavididi, who has lost his place to Bobby De Cordova-Reid.

The transfer market is active until Friday, August 30. After 11pm on that date, no Premier League moves can be made. So City bosses must act fast if they are in fact serious about targeting a goalscorer. Another one is definitely needed.

Either way, some Leicester starlets are supposedly off. Nelson might join Bristol City on loan. Braybrooke will temporarily switch to Dundee FC. While Sunderland have offered £5 million for Cannon. Cooper also hinted at a loan for Alves.
